What to Expect from Overnight Pet Boarding


When your pets stay overnight at DoGone Fun, you can rest assured that they’ll have a great time. If you’re wondering what to expect from overnight pet boarding, this is what pets typically go through during their stay.


Check-In
When you bring your pets in for boarding, we’ll give you time to say goodbye before taking them back to the kennels or play area. Please have your check-in form filled out for us, so we’ll have all of the information we need for your pets’ stay.


Playtime
If you drop your pets off in the morning or afternoon, they can play with other dogs in the play area. We provide pets with time to rest during the day, so they don’t get overexcited.


Training
We offer training for pets that are boarding. If your pets could use some obedience training or if they need to learn specific commands, we can work with them while they’re at our boarding facility. We offer training classes and one-on-one instruction.


Meals
Our overnight pet boarding facility serves meals at regular times each day. We’ll feed your pets their regular food, or you can indicate that you want them to eat the food we provide at our facility. If your pets have special diets, please let us know, so we can accommodate them.


Elimination
Your pets will have plenty of opportunities to eliminate during their overnight stay. They can do so while playing outside or going for a walk. Our staff members clean up after your pets right away in order to keep our facility clean.


Bedtime
When it’s time for bed, your pets will stay in a comfortable kennel with a polar fleece blanket. For an extra fee, you can arrange one-on-one cuddle time for them, a biscuit, or a Kong filled with goodies. You can also arrange for an extra comfortable bed for them for an extra fee.


Grooming
Our staff members can give your pets a bath, trim their nails and provide other grooming services if you want. Just let us know which grooming services you would like for your pets.
